Specifications

  • Microcontroller architecture: 8-bit
  • Flash program memory: 32 KB
  • RAM: 1.75 KB
  • Operating voltage range: 2.3V to 5.5V
  • Maximum operating frequency: 64 MHz
  • Number of I/O pins: 25
  •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C): 10-bit, 13 channels
  • Communication interfaces: UART, SPI, I2C
  • Timers: 4 x 8-bit, 1 x 16-bit
  • Operating temperature range: -40°C to +125°C

  1. Question: What is the maximum operating frequency of PIC18LF25K50-E/SP?
    Answer: The maximum operating frequency of PIC18LF25K50-E/SP is 64 MHz.

  2. Question: What are the key features of PIC18LF25K50-E/SP?
    Answer: Some key features of PIC18LF25K50-E/SP include 32 KB Flash program memory, 1.8 KB RAM, and 256 bytes of EEPROM data memory.

  3. Question: Can PIC18LF25K50-E/SP be used for USB applications?
    Answer: Yes, PIC18LF25K50-E/SP has built-in USB 2.0 support, making it suitable for USB applications.

  4. Question: What voltage range does PIC18LF25K50-E/SP operate at?
    Answer: PIC18LF25K50-E/SP operates in the voltage range of 2.0V to 5.5V.

  5. Question: Is PIC18LF25K50-E/SP suitable for low-power applications?
    Answer: Yes, PIC18LF25K50-E/SP is designed for low-power applications with its low power consumption features.

  6. Question: Does PIC18LF25K50-E/SP have analog-to-digital conversion (ADC) capabilities?
    Answer: Yes, PIC18LF25K50-E/SP features a 10-bit ADC module with up to 13 channels.

  7. Question: Can PIC18LF25K50-E/SP be programmed using C language?
    Answer: Yes, PIC18LF25K50-E/SP can be programmed using the C language with the appropriate compiler.

  8. Question: What communication interfaces are supported by PIC18LF25K50-E/SP?
    Answer: PIC18LF25K50-E/SP supports SPI, I2C, and UART communication interfaces.

  9. Question: Is PIC18LF25K50-E/SP suitable for motor control applications?
    Answer: Yes, PIC18LF25K50-E/SP can be used for motor control applications with its PWM and timer modules.

  10. Question: Are there development tools available for PIC18LF25K50-E/SP?
    Answer: Yes, there are various development tools and software libraries available for PIC18LF25K50-E/SP to aid in application development.
